History of All Blacks week 3

1. When was rugby introduced to New Zealand and by who?
A. Rugby was introduced to New Zealand in 1870 by Charles Monro.

2. When did New Zealand play their first game?
A. The teams first match was in 1884.

3. When did New Zealand play the first international game?

4. when was the New Zealand team called All Blacks?
 Why and how did they become known as All Blacks?
A. They were called All Blacks in 1905. They were called 
All Blacks because of their black uniform.

5. Name three of the best players and what they’re known for.
A. Richie McCaw who hold the world record for test appearances.
Jonah Tali Lamu, Lamu is usually referred to as the first 
global superstar of the rugby union. Colin Meads, Meads was
so dedicated to the sport he even played with a broken arm.

6. What do the All Blacks preform before each match? What does 
it mean why they perform it?
A. For the all black games they do a Haka, it’s a traditional 
war dance. The other team know that they are serious and bringing
their all.
